Quality Manager Location: Moses Lake, WA Reporting to: Director, Operations Open to Relocation: Yes On-Site/Hybrid/Remote: On-Site Travel Required: 0% Job Summary The Quality Manager will be responsible for leading the Quality organization to enhance business performance and drive a positive continuous improvement culture that is focused on delivering value to the customer. This includes defining and improving quality standards, specifications, and other technical data necessary to meet design intent and manufacturing requirements. Highlights Great work environment Industry leading, highly competitive compensation Steady workload Outstanding benefits package to take care of who’s important to you Experience a committed safety culture Personalized and dedicated support team to keep you on the move What You'll Do Ensure compliance to quality policy, procedures and work instructions, documented quality systems, and all Occupational Health and Safety (OH&S) procedures, policies and work instructions. In addition, ensure compliance to statutory and regulatory requirements. The establishment and approval of quality system procedures and standards aligned with emerging segment standards and customer requirement. Establish and support appropriate measurements to monitor internal compliance with approved quality goals and objectives. Initiate the use of world class quality tools, systems and procedures to support the overall operational goals. Develop methods to monitor process parameters in cooperation with production management to provide useful feedback for effective process control and improvement. Participate in disposition and root cause analysis of discrepant material and corrective actions to prevent further discrepancies. Works closely with segment Supplier Quality and Design Engineering teams to improve supplier performance. As a member of the extended global Quality team, assist in the development of a segment-wide system for identifying, tracking, and reporting customer concerns, internal quality issues, supplier quality issues, and appropriate corrective action activities. Assess and implement the appropriate data analysis, quality systems, and inspection criteria and procedures to ensure the high technical integrity of our quality processes and results. Provide and administer an effective system for identifying, tracking, and reporting improvement initiatives. Participate in product development to identify and develop PFMEA, Control Plans, and Critical to Quality attributes to be integrated in production instructions. Provide and administer a program for required internal quality system audits. Develops strategies and programs that improve the quality and efficiency of the various work processes of the company. Develop and maintain relationships with commercial teams, ensuring the voice of the customer is incorporated in Quality measurement and improvement plans. Directs technical and administrative workers engaged in quality assurance activities. Carries out supervisory responsibilities in accordance with the organization's policies and applicable laws. Responsibilities include interviewing, hiring, and training employees; planning, assigning, and directing work; appraising performance; rewarding and disciplining employees; addressing complaints and resolving problems. What You'll Bring Bachelor's degree or higher in business, engineering, or similar relevant field and/or 3-5 years experience in quality management activities such as quality systems development, customer and supplier quality relations, process controls, and/or corrective and preventive action Ability and willingness to work in-person in Moses Lake, WA Nice to Have's Experience implementing quality systems in the manufacturing industry 5 years of experience with the use of corrective actions, root cause analysis, statistical methods, advanced product quality planning (APQP) and failure modes and effects analysis (FMEA). Knowledge and functional experience in an ISO Quality Management Systems environment preferred. Excellent problem solving skills and analytical abilities. Statistical training, computer skills, related technical background preferred. Strong leadership, communication and interpersonal skills with ability to interact with all levels of employees and customers. Demonstrated ability in developing and implementing supplier development programs. Demonstrated experience as a change agent in driving a cultural shift from inspection based systems to more proactive, process focused environment. Knowledge of and use of Lean Principles; continuous improvement, process management, 3P, cost downs, TQM (Total Quality Management), Kaizen events, quality containment, root cause analysis, supplier reliability and control plans. About Terex Terex Corporation is a global leader in specialized equipment solutions, serving essential sectors such as emergency services, waste and recycling, utilities, and construction. Our diversified portfolio positions us in resilient, high‑demands markets with strong long‑term growth potential. We design and manufacture advanced specialty vehicles—including fire, ambulance, and recreational vehicles—alongside waste collection vehicles, materials processing machinery, mobile elevating work platforms, and equipment for the electric utility industry. Through our global dealer, parts and service network and true value‑creating digital solutions, we deliver best‑in‑class lifecycle support, helping customers maximize return on investment. With a strong manufacturing footprint in the United States and operations across Europe, India, and Asia Pacific, Terex combines global reach with local expertise to capture opportunities worldwide.
